Russia condemns 'Israeli' air strikes on Syria
Source: BBC
The foreign ministry of Russia, a key Syrian ally, said it was "very concerned" by the alleged Israeli air strikes.
"The provocative actions of the Israeli air force... directly threatened two airliners," it said.
The statement said the unidentified airliners "not from Russia, were preparing to land at the airports of Beirut and Damascus".
The Syrian military said the attacks were carried out from within Lebanese air space. Syrian state news agency, Sana, said most of the missiles were intercepted.
